Classification of Criminal Offenses Criminal statutes in every state have multiple categories of criminal offenses, which often include felonies, misdemeanors, and infractions. To simplify the classification process, a number of commonly generated wastes have been pre-classified as either hazardous, restricted solid, general solid waste (putrescible) or general solid waste (non-putrescible) in the waste classification definition section of Schedule 1 of the Protection of the Environment Operations Act 1997 (POEO Act).
